The Cryptologic and Cyber Systems Division (AFLCMC/HNC) is a one-of-a-kind Air Force activity operating from Lackland AFB which provides life cycle management for IA and other critical systems. The division’s primary mission is cyberspace support. AFLCMC/HNC is responsible for technology development, acquisition, sustainment, and demilitarization of cyber security systems or products that provide mission assurance by ensuring warfighter access to the information systems and its products, while denying adversaries access to the same. The division also provides product support to other critical Air Force, DoD, and national force protection and intelligence systems required by the nation to mobilize, deploy, support, and sustain operations.
